Abstract
N-(4-Methyl-3-tolylthiazol-2(3H)-ylidene) substituted benzamides (2a-o) were synthesized in good to excellent yields by the base-catalyzed direct cyclization of corresponding 1-tolyl-3-aryl thioureas (1a-o) with 2-bromoacetone through microwave irradiation in a solvent-free medium. Compared to traditional thermal heating, microwave irradiation provides a much more cleaner, efficient and faster method for synthesis of the title compounds.
